The Largest Theatre in the World: The Rainbirds
w.
Clive Exton |
Thursday
11 February 1971, 9.20pm |
Capsule Description:
John Rainbird is in a coma after a suicide attempt. He falls prey to fantasies involving his relatives and nightmare creatures. © Radio Times 1971
This capsule description will, ultimately, be replaced by an essay once it is uploaded.
Duration: 1'05". Archive: BBC holds 16mm Eastmancolour mute positives (two reels), 16mm Eastmancolour mute negatives (four reels of A/B rolls), separate magnetic audio track, VideoCD, timecoded VHS.
Written by Clive
Exton. Directed by Philip Savile.
Produced by Irene Shubik.
Designer: John Burrowes, Sound: Doug Mawson, Alan Dykes, Photography: Ken
Westbury, Film Editor: Tony Woolard.
Cast: Madge Ryan (Mrs Rainbird), James Cossins (Mr Rainbird), Alan Webb (Grandfather), Peter Jeffrey (The Doctor), Andrew Grant (John Rainbird), Paddy Joyce (Hotel Porter), Wendy Hamilton (Nurse), Claire Davenport (Nurse), Billie Laine (Nurse), Paul Hardwick (Recruiting Sgt), Anthony Ainley (Surgeon), David Markham (The Padre), Jerry Ram (Young Doctor), Richard Kerley (Young Doctor), Amber Blair (Club Hostess), Andrea Southern (Stripper).
